Tigress electrocuted in Kabini backwaters

Mysuru: A four-year-old tigress’ carcass was discovered in the Kabini backwaters on Wednesday morning. Officials of Karnataka Forest Department opined that the tigress had been electrocuted near a farm.

The farm owners had removed the nails of the animal. But, fearing reprisal, they had discarded the carcass along with the nails (stashed together in a plastic cover) in the backwaters adjoining the Jungle Lodges and Resorts.

During post-mortem, the vet concluded that the tigress had died due to electrocution as its heart had been reduced to ashes.

Investigations are on. Suspects are absconding from the village adjoining Nagarhole Tiger Reserve.
